And the gut is so connected to the brain that they might as well be right next to each other, talking to one another. There's several ways. I mean, we could literally unpack for an hour the many ways in which the gut is talking to the brain. I'll summarize it real quick, that your microbes are producing chemicals. There's many of them.

And your microbes are producing chemicals that will ultimately enter the bloodstream. And when they get into the bloodstream, within a matter of seconds, your heart will circulate that blood up to the brain. And those chemicals have influence. on the blood brain barrier. So the brain is encapsulated by this protective wall.

And that protective wall actually is made up with the exact same cellular architecture as your gut barrier. So things that can heal your gut barrier can also heal your blood brain barrier. And things that harm your gut barrier will also harm your brain barrier.

And this is a perfect example of how these things are interconnected because when something is harming your gut, it will also harm your brain. But also those chemicals, many of them, many of them will cross the blood brain barrier and have influence there. Your gut is the second most dominant location in terms of nerves in your body. So you have 500 million nerves within your gut.

That is, by the way, five times what you will find in your spinal cord. And that's why we refer to this as the enteric nervous system or the second brain. And all those 500 million nerves are feeling and sensing as we sit here and speak to one another constantly, not in the same way that my fingertip does, it's a little bit different, but they're feeling and they serve a purpose.

And that information gets basically brought together into the vagus nerve. And the vagus nerve, which is a pair of nerves that basically connect our brain down to our heart, our lungs, and dominantly our gut, The vagus nerve is the information superhighway. It's carrying that, all those 500 million nerves worth of info back up to the brain, which is influencing brain function.
